The organizer of the hacking competition Pwn2Own is relatively certain: Microsoft’s Windows 7 is more secure than Apple’s Mac OS, Snow Leopard.Another weak point is Apple’s Safari browser.
Pwn2Own is a hacker competition in which the best hacker in order to cash prizes of up to $ 100,000 to chop the bet. Aaron Portnoy, who is organizing the spectacle itself, ensuring that Apple’s Safari is cracked first. Also last year there were already the same competition and one of the participating hackers succeeded in a record 5 (enter!) Seconds on Safari on a Mac. The year before, was broken after less than 2 minutes a Macbook Air.
In both cases, the managed entry in Apple’s operating system via the Safari browser, which has proved to be a major flaw here and compared with Windows browsers Firefox and Internet Explorer has fallen significantly. A possible reason for this is also the high functionality of Safari. PDF and Flash can display the browser for example, by default. This can provide a greater target for hackers.
